A strong 6.2-magnitude earthquake struck off the coast of Sri Lanka on Tuesday afternoon. The quake occurred around 12:31 pm IST, with an epicenter located 1,326 km southeast of the capital Colombo. Tremors were felt across parts of Sri Lanka, including in Colombo. According to the National Center for Seismology, the earthquake struck at a depth of 10 km in the Indian Ocean. There have been no immediate reports of casualties or major damage. Authorities are assessing the impact of the seismic activity. [ photo courtesy: NCS_Earthquake/X ]
